在信息化快速发展的,美容行业对高效管理和优质客户服务的需求日益增长。为了提升美容院的运营效率和客户满意度,开发一套基于Java的美容用品管理系统显得尤为重要。
系统概述
美容用品管理系统是一个综合性的应用,旨在通过自动化和数字化流程,提高美容院的运营效率和客户体验。该系统通常分为管理后台和用户网页端,支持管理员、技师和前台等不同角色的使用。管理后台负责处理日常运营和管理任务,如技师管理、美容用品管理、美容项目管理、用户预约管理等;用户网页端则为客户提供在线预约、查看服务详情和购买美容用品等功能。
具体案例
以基于SpringBoot和Vue.js的美容院管理系统为例,该系统通过前后端分离的方式,实现了美容用品管理、美容项目管理、用户预约管理、数据分析等多个功能模块。
美容用品管理:管理员可以跟踪库存、进行采购和销售记录,确保美容院的运营需求得到满足。
美容项目管理:允许添加、更新和删除服务项目,设置价格和描述,以吸引和满足客户需求。
用户预约管理:提供了一个在线预约系统,允许客户预约服务,提供实时的预约安排和调度。
数据分析:利用收集的数据进行分析,帮助管理者做出基于数据的决策,优化业务流程和提高客户满意度。
该系统的运行效果显著,不仅提高了美容院的运营效率,还显著提升了客户满意度。例如,技师可以通过统计报表查看各种美容用品的现有库存量,及时补充库存;管理员可以查看销量统计报表,了解各种美容用品的销量信息,制定采购计划;客户可以在线预约服务,查看服务详情,购买美容用品,大大提升了客户体验。
Java实现
基于Java的美容用品管理系统通常使用SpringBoot作为后端框架,Vue.js作为前端框架,MySQL作为数据库。以下是一个简单的实现步骤:
环境搭建:
安装开发工具:IntelliJ IDEA或Eclipse。
安装数据库:MySQL 5或8。
安装服务器:Tomcat(版本随意)。
项目结构:
后端:使用SpringBoot框架,包含控制器、服务、实体和仓库等层。
前端:使用Vue.js框架,包含组件、路由和状态管理等。
数据库:设计数据表结构,如美容用品信息表、用户信息表、预约信息表等。
功能实现:
登录功能:实现用户登录验证,包括管理员、技师和普通用户。
美容用品管理:实现美容用品的增删改查功能,以及库存统计功能。
美容项目管理:实现美容项目的增删改查功能,以及价格设置和描述功能。
用户预约管理:实现在线预约功能,包括预约信息的增删改查和审核功能。
数据分析:实现销量统计、客户行为分析等功能,提供可视化报表。
系统测试:
进行单元测试、集成测试和系统测试,确保系统的稳定性和可靠性。
测试用户登录、美容用品查询、预约信息管理等功能,确保功能实现正确。
部署上线:
将系统部署到服务器上,进行性能测试和压力测试。
根据测试结果进行优化和调整,确保系统稳定运行。
美容用品源码软件的搭建是一个复杂而细致的过程,需要综合考虑系统的功能需求、技术选型、开发环境等多个方面。通过合理的系统设计和功能实现,可以显著提升美容院的运营效率和客户满意度。希望本文的介绍能够为读者提供有益的参考和借鉴。